Explore a comprehensive guide to successfully integrate Bubble.io with YouTube API. Follow simple steps for seamless integration and usage.
YouTube API, or Application Programming Interface, is a set of web protocols developed by Google for accessing and manipulating data from YouTube services. It allows developers to integrate YouTube's video content and functionality into websites, applications, and devices. It provides options to search for videos, retrieve standard feeds, and see related content, with features to manipulate playlists, manage video uploads, and update user settings. It enables the creation of inventive applications powered by YouTube's extensive video resource.
Book a call with an Expert
Starting a new venture? Need to upgrade your web or mobile app? RapidDev builds Bubble apps with your growth in mind.
Step 1: Create Your API Key in Google Cloud
Begin by creating an API key in the Google Cloud.
Step 2: Set Up The Plugin in Bubble.io
Next, you set up the API in Bubble.io to communicate with YouTube.
Step 3: Configure YouTube API Connectivity
In this step, you configure the YouTube API's connectivity to define how it should function.
Step 4: Verify API Connections
The verification of API connections ensures all setup steps were successful.
Step 5: Use API in Application
Lastly, you have to specify where and how to use the API in your application.
With this, the integration of Bubble.io with YouTube API is complete. You can now make API calls within your Bubble.io application and extend its functionality using the YouTube API.
Scenario: An online education platform wants to enhance the learning experience for its students. The platform itself is built using Bubble.io and they have a variety of tutorial videos uploaded on YouTube. However, the platform wants these videos to be more accessible to their students by embedding them directly within their platform. They want to use YouTube's API to integrate the videos and have them play directly from the platform's website.
Solution: Integration of Bubble.io with YouTube API
Platform Design: The web development team designs the platform using Bubble.io, adding spaces where they wish the videos to be embedded.
API Integration: The team obtains the YouTube API key and configures the Bubble.io platform settings to include the API. They configure the API so that specific video ids match with corresponding lessons and courses on the platform.
Video Embedding Workflow: The specific ids are matched with their respective courses and are all embedded as per the design plan. When a new course opens, the corresponding YouTube video also plays, allowing students to watch it directly from the platform without being redirected to YouTube.
Engaging Learning Experience: Students now have an enhanced learning experience where theory, visuals, and practice work together, solidifying their understanding of the course material.
Monitoring and Analytics: The integration also allows data to be collected about the students' engagement with the videos like how many students watched them, average watch time, etc. This data can be used to make improvements and adjustments to the course content.
Benefits:
Ease of Learning: By integrating YouTube with the Bubble.io platform, students have a more streamlined and efficient study process, saving time otherwise spent on searching for the specific tutorial videos.
Enhanced User Experience: The integration improves the overall user experience as learners get everything they need in one place.
Improved Content: Analyzing student engagement with the videos helps to refine and improve course content, fostering further learning.
Increased Engagement: Providing multimedia content engages students better and can help them understand the material effectively, which can increase retention and success rates. Performance tracking also becomes more insightful with integrated data from platform and video engagements.
By integrating YouTube API into Bubble.io, the online education platform significantly enhances its learning environment by creating an interactive and engaging learning process.
Delve into comprehensive reviews of top no-code tools to find the perfect platform for your development needs. Explore expert insights, user feedback, and detailed comparisons to make informed decisions and accelerate your no-code project development.
Discover our comprehensive WeWeb tutorial directory tailored for all skill levels. Unlock the potential of no-code development with our detailed guides, walkthroughs, and practical tips designed to elevate your WeWeb projects.
Discover the best no-code tools for your projects with our detailed comparisons and side-by-side reviews. Evaluate features, usability, and performance across leading platforms to choose the tool that fits your development needs and enhances your productivity.
Then all you have to do is schedule your free consultation. During our first discussion, we’ll sketch out a high-level plan, provide you with a timeline, and give you an estimate.